#97f992 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#97f992 is composed of 59.2% red, 97.6%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 117.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 77.5%. #97f992 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2ff325.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#97f992 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#97f992 has RGB values of R:151, G:249,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 9959826.

Shades and Tints of #97f992
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000300 is the darkest color, while #f0feef is the lightest one.

Tones of #97f992
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3c8c3 is the less saturated color, while #93fd8e is the most saturated one.
